Captain Ian O'Manion is a man with three names and a perilous past.... As Ian O'Malley, he's wanted by the English. He's wanted by the French as Jean Delacorte. When he wins The Oaks, a Maryland horse farm, he takes a new name for his new life...until the past catches up to him, with a vengeance. Ian returns to The Oaks with a festering gunshot wound, fractured bones, and a broken spirit. Haunted by abuses suffered in a Jamaican prison, devoid of hope after his botched escape, he believes that he's come home to die. Elsbeth Gordon is an indentured servant with dangerous secrets of her own .... A young woman of power, Beth talks to trees, communicates with animals, and practices magick alone. When healing the Captain means sharing her secrets, Beth has no choice but to risk being burned as a witch. The psychically gifted beekeeper sees the promise of their future in his eyes...if they can survive an old enemy and an ancient evil that threaten to destroy them both. Written for ages 18+.
